Don Satz, presumably wearing his armour and helmet, announced: >I've decided to take the plunge into Rachmaninov's symphonies.. and asked for recommendations. I like the Ashkenazy versions with the Concertgebouw on Decca (London in US?) which include his little one-movement Brucknerian Youth Symphony. A friend recently picked up the Ormandy versions which don't quite come with a free set of steak knives, but they are very cheap. Ormandy had - and still has - his detractors but IMO his way with Rachmaninov better than most. Whoever you buy, many people have done cut-and-paste jobs on the 2nd, so care is advised.
